<application>Tremulous</application> is a free, open source game that blends a team based First Person Shooter (FPS) with elements of a Real Time Strategy (RTS) game. Players can choose from two unique races, aliens and humans. The objective is to eliminate the opposing team by not only killing the opposing players but also removing their ability to respawn by destroying the spawn structures. More information about the game can be found on the <ulink url="http://tremulous.net/">Tremulous website</ulink>.

<application>Nexuiz</application> is a 3D deathmatch game based on the Darkplaces engine, which is an advanced <emphasis>Quake 1</emphasis> engine built on OpenGL technology. It includes 17 maps, 15 player models, advanced UI, and an available master server allowing you to play people from all over the world. More information about the game can be found on the <ulink url="http://www.alientrap.org/nexuiz/index.php">Nexuiz website</ulink>.

<application>KBounce</application> is a game where the object is to catch several moving balls in a rectangular game field by building walls. More balls are added with each level that you complete successfully; how many can you catch?

<application>Kolf</application> is a miniature golf game played with an overhead view, with a short bar representing the golf club and direction of the intended shot. It features various courses, a course editor, water hazards, slopes, sand traps, and black holes.
